톨루엔-노말헵탄 혼합물의 액막분리에 있어서 추출용제의 영향
Effect of Extractive Solvents on Separability of Toluene-n-Heptane Mixture by Liquid Membrane
톨루엔과 노말헵탄 혼합물을 액막에 의하여 분리함에 있어서 분리기능을 향상시키기 위하여 설포레인, 메틸 설폰, 트리에틸렌 글리콜과 같은 추출용제를 첨가하였다. 추출용제의 종류와 농도 그리고 접촉시간이 분리계수와 투과율에 미치는 영향을 분석하였다. 추출용제의 농도가 증가함에 따라 톨루엔과 노말헵탄의 투과율이 증가하였다. 설포레인을 첨가했을 경우에 10 부피%와 접촉시간 10분에서 첨가하지 않은 경우보다 높은 분리계수를 나타내었다. 소디움 로릴 설페이트 0.5 무게%에서 가장 낮은 막 파괴율을 나타내었으며 또한 가장 높은 분리계수를 얻을 수 있었다.
In the separation of toluene-n-heptane mixture by liquid membrane, extractive solvents such as sulfolane, methyl sulfone and triethylene glycol were intermixed with membrane to improve the separability. Detailed analysis was carried out concerning the effects of such factors as the type and the concentration of extraction solvents and the contact time on the permeability and separation factor. As the extractive solvent concentration increased, the permeation of toluene and n-heptane increased. With 10 vol% of sulfolane a higher separation factor than with no sulfolane was achicved at the contact time of 10 minutes. The percentage of membrane breakup was smallest when the concentration of sodium lauryl sulfate was 0.5 wt% where the separation factor reached its highest value.
